Parker’s New Hires Support Regional Growth

Chain adds real estate, financial services veterans

SAVANNAH, Ga. — Convenience-store retailer Parker’s has hired two new team members, H.L. Scottie Hendrix II and Sarah Sullivan, to support the company’s growth and continued expansion across coastal Georgia and South Carolina.

Scottie Hendrix

H.L. Scottie Hendrix II, an attorney and former real estate agent, has joined the company as commercial real estate counsel. He leads the company’s commercial real estate division, manages all aspects of commercial real estate transactions and supports Parker’s General Counsel Blake Greco.

Prior to joining Parker’s, Hendrix practiced law at two Savannah, Ga. firms, served as a Realty Specialist for the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ers and negotiated the purchase, sale and lease of Norfolk Southern Railway Co.’s property interests in Georgia, New York and Pennsylvania.

An experienced financial expert, Sarah Sullivan joins Parker’s after serving as executive assistant at Ele and the Chef Restaurant Group in Savannah, Ga., where she provided administrative and management support to 11 restaurants and their managers. Sullivan brings five years of experience in financial reporting, bank reconciliation, accounts receivable, accounts payable and payroll administration to her new position and previously worked at Stein Accounting and Potter Construction in Savannah, Ga. As the financial services manager at Parker’s, Sullivan analyzes financial data, assets and budgets, establishes reporting processes and maintains relationships with key business and investment partners.

Based in Savannah, the 68-store company has convenience stores in Georgia and South Carolina. Parker’s Kitchen, the food-centric brand under the Parker’s umbrella, serves southern fried chicken tenders as well as macaroni and cheese, a breakfast bar and daily specials. The chain’s Parker’s Rewards loyalty program includes more than 210,000 members.
